From 68bd7add003aa2209dbed3ad37cd1545b254b959 Mon Sep 17 00:00:00 2001 From: Vadim Yalovets Date: Mon, 23 Dec 2024 18:00:54 +0200 Subject: [PATCH] RM-1471 PXB 8.0.35-32 (#1101) --- percona-xtrabackup-8.0/Dockerfile | 16 +++++++++++----- 1 file changed, 11 insertions(+), 5 deletions(-) diff --git a/percona-xtrabackup-8.0/Dockerfile b/percona-xtrabackup-8.0/Dockerfile index bed39665..0b7cad5d 100644 --- a/percona-xtrabackup-8.0/Dockerfile +++ b/percona-xtrabackup-8.0/Dockerfile @@ -5,8 +5,8 @@ LABEL org.opencontainers.image.authors="info@percona.com" RUN microdnf -y update; \ microdnf -y install glibc-langpack-en -ENV XTRABACKUP_VERSION 8.0.35-31.1 -ENV PS_VERSION 8.0.36-28.1 +ENV XTRABACKUP_VERSION 8.0.35-32.1 +ENV PS_VERSION 8.0.39-30.1 ENV OS_VER el9 ENV FULL_PERCONA_VERSION "$PS_VERSION.$OS_VER" ENV FULL_PERCONA_XTRABACKUP_VERSION "$XTRABACKUP_VERSION.$OS_VER" @@ -27,8 +27,9 @@ RUN set -ex; \ #microdnf -y module disable mysql perl-DBD-MySQL; \ percona-release disable all; \ #percona-release setup -y ps-80; \ - percona-release enable ps-80 release; \ - percona-release enable tools testing + percona-release enable ps-80; \ + percona-release enable tools testing; \ + percona-release enable pxb-80 testing RUN set -ex; \ microdnf -y install \ @@ -40,8 +41,13 @@ RUN groupadd -g 1001 mysql; \ useradd -u 1001 -r -g 1001 -s /sbin/nologin \ -c "Default Application User" mysql +RUN if [ "$(uname -m)" = "x86_64" ]; then \ + curl -Lf -o /tmp/libev.rpm https://downloads.percona.com/downloads/packaging/libev-4.33-5.el9.x86_64.rpm; \ + else \ + curl -Lf -o /tmp/libev.rpm https://mirror.stream.centos.org/9-stream/BaseOS/aarch64/os/Packages/libev-4.33-5.el9.aarch64.rpm; \ + fi + RUN set -ex; \ - curl -Lf -o /tmp/libev.rpm https://downloads.percona.com/downloads/packaging/libev-4.33-5.el9.x86_64.rpm; \ rpm -i /tmp/libev.rpm; \ rm -rf /tmp/libev.rpm; \ #dnf --setopt=install_weak_deps=False --best install -y \